Genzyme and Isis Pharmaceuticals: Phase 3 mipomersen study in heFH patients meets primary endpoint

Published February 10, 2010, 5:11 am, News-Medical-Net

Genzyme Corp. and Isis Pharmaceuticals Inc. today announced that the phase 3 study of mipomersen in patients with heterozygous familial hypercholesterolemia (heFH) met its primary endpoint with a highly statistically significant 28 percent reduction in LDL-cholesterol after 26 weeks of treatment, compared with an increase of 5 percent for placebo.

Spithill earns his wings for Oracle

Published February 10, 2010, 5:04 am, Brisbane Times

When Australian sailor James Spithill talks about piloting Oracle, the America's Cup finalist from the US, you can take him literally. Spithill decided to get his pilot's licence to help him sail the giant trimaran, whose solid vertical wingspan of 68 metres is more than twice the length of the wing of a Boeing 747.
